I got this bike with 1400 original miles in early 2016 and put 5600 on it this summer. It's been a fantastic bike. I keep the chain lubed and the oil changed with Yama lube and Yamaha Filters.


I laid it down at about 20 mph and have since replaced everything with factory Yamaha parts. Everyone makes a big deal about never wrecked never down but honestly who cares as long as it still rides like new and is still a clean title? The only way you can still tell it's been down is the muffler and clutch cover are scratched. All else has been replaced. Email me for details.

The bike has EBC HH pads all around and Hel Performance Braided steel brake lines. The exhaust is shipped over from the UK made by SP Engineering (stock exhaust undamaged and included). With the exhaust it has a Graves Motorsports EXUP eliminator. Otherwise is stock. The motor is a slightly de-tuned R1 engine with slightly different gearing in the trans. This bike is fast! Clean title in my name in hand. Tags good to 01, 2018. Includes waterproof bike cover.

Police Catch Up with Motorcycle Doing 185 mph in YouTube Video

Fri, 20 Apr 2012

Authorities in British Columbia, Canada, have impounded a 2006 Yamaha R1 believed to have starred in a YouTube video reaching speeds of 299 kph (185 mph) on a freeway. The onboard video, embedded after the jump, captures the Yamaha weaving through traffic, and often lane-splitting between other vehicles, covering a 4.67 mile stretch of the Trans-Canada Highway in about a minute and 56 seconds. That translates to an average speed of 144.6 mph.

Ben Spies Signs Contract Extension with Yamaha

Wed, 08 Jun 2011

Yamaha has signed Ben Spies to a one-year contract extension to continue racing on its MotoGP factory team in 2012. The extension comes after Spies, currently seventh in the Championship standings, recorded his first podium finish of the 2011 season, a third place result at Catalunya. Spies earned two other podium finishes in 2010 in his Rookie of the Year winning debut in the class with the Tech 3 satellite team.

Yamaha Reports Q2 2011 Results

Wed, 03 Aug 2011

A drop in net sales, an appreciating yen and the fallout from the March 11 earthquake and tsunamis in Japan contributed to a 4.6% drop in profit for Yamaha Motor Co. over the second quarter of 2011. Over the quarter ended June 30, 2011, Yamaha saw a 5.9% drop in net sales compared to the same period in 2010.Yamaha reports sales of 344.5 billion yen (US$4.48 billion) over the second quarter, compared to the 366.3 billion yen (US$4.77 billion) reported in the same quarter in 2010.
